#2 — February 2015

After testing this blade with so many rubbers, I was initially disappointed with it. However, I eventually found the rubber that suits this special blade: Calibra Tour M.

The combination of this blade and rubber is amazing. The Tour M is so linear that it even makes the iolite Neo (a balsa core blade) play more linearly. And once this ultra-fast blade becomes more linear, it has everything an attacker could dream of: a neutral throw, absolute power, amazing dwell time, incredible spin, great consistency, and a light weight. It becomes so easy to generate powerful topspins with this setup.

The only issue is finding a second blade like this, as it is very hard to come by in 2015.

#3 — September 2013

I think the blade has a very soft feel. Although this totally irritated me in the beginning,

It is very light; still very fast and not stiff like the usual carbon blade.

I have kept it because I like the soft feeling and will try to use it again.

It is definitely faster than Innerforce ULC, ZLC, ZLF, and Gergely alpha.

Maybe a little slower than Schlager Carbon Off+.
